Placements: There is a placement cell in our college. Companies like Amazon, Genpact, Tata Power, DDL, etc., arrive for placements. The college has tie-ups with Internshala and Interntheory for providing internships. The interns get stipends and certificates. In my course, very few students applied for placements, and therefore, only 5% of students enrolled in placements. The highest package was 15,000-20,000 per month, and the lowest salary was 5,000 per month.

Placements: The highest salary package is Rs.35,000 per month and the lowest salary package is Rs.20,000 per month. Private companies like Fortis and max fort offer placements. Around 5% of students got placed. Psychologists, psychotherapists, counselors, educators, etc. are the roles offered.
